Calvados was written by Pete Doherty.
Calvados was produced by Mike Moore.
Pete Doherty released Calvados on Wed Feb 26 2025.
Where I live there’s a fellow in town, he’s got a shop that specialises in Calvados and ciders; the apple juice becomes cider becomes Calvados. He took me on a tour of all the old Calvados makers, in his van, place to place, staying with them. It’s that story.
